Zen Mind, Beginner’s Mind: Informal Talks on Zen Meditation and Practice

Book Image

By Shunryu Suzuki — 2011

"In the beginner's mind there are many possibilities, but in the expert's there are few." So begins this most beloved of all American Zen books. Seldom has such a small handful of words provided a teaching as rich as has this famous opening line of Shunryu Suzuki's classic. See more...
